Green Hydrogen to be a game changer to move towards innovation

By October 23, 2021 6:28 pm IST

Green Hydrogen to be a game changer to move towards innovation

Hydrogen can reduce over $160 bn worth of imports for India.

Leading scientist and innovation evangelist, Dr R.A Mashelkar, Chief Guest on day 3 of IEEMA’s Digielec Bharat 2021, addressed a special session. He shared his vision on Green Hydrogen driven green revolution in India. 

Speaking on the occasion he articulated, “There has been an exponential growth in Hydrogen deployment globally. Green hydrogen has moved from hype to hope and there are 359 large scale H2 projects announced and an estimated investment worth USD 510 bn by 2030. 75+ countries have net-zero carbon ambition and 31 countries have already implemented the strategies. I believe policies should be made considering the carbon impact, complexity of hydrogen infrastructure investment and future changes to carbon pricing or import taxes, once subsidies are phased out to ensure competitiveness to existing conventional fuel.”

, “Green hydrogen will play a key role in the energy transition and it can reduce over US$160 bn worth of import for India. Countries like USA, Australia, India and Japan have decided to cooperate development for clean hydrogen value chain.”

He also cited steps required going forward and mentioned, “Graded market development for hydrogen will encourage private sector investment through competitive bidding. Also a framework for incentives and alignment with Make in India and Atma Nirbhar Bharat need to be developed with specific zones (H2 Hub) and Grid balancing. Technology should be supported by Bold Policy decisions, patient capital and public-private partnerships.”

Dr Mashelkar concluded his session stating, “I am dangerously optimistic about India. Talent, Technology and Trust will help our Nation become a world leader in affordable excellence.”

Vipul Ray, President, IEEMA, expressed, “Digielec Bharat is a culmination of Digitisation, Standardisation & Indianisation, taking forward the clarion call of Prime Minister on Atmanirbhar Bharat. Going forward Hydrogen will play a very critical role in shaping the power sector globally.”
